Iron Choreographer Crown Up for Grabs at RDT's Charette, 02/22
by Hilary Kelly - Jan 31, 2014

Repertory Dance Theatre's Charette returns for the ninth time on February 22, 2014 with an all new host, Sister Dottie S. Dixon. Based loosely on TV's 'Iron Chef,' Charette challenges five choreographers to each create an entirely new dance piece in just one hour. Audience members are invited to watch the choreographic process and vote for their favorite to crown this year's Iron Choreographer.

DNA Announces NYC Curatorial Debut for Jaamil Olawale Kosoko
by Kelsey Denette - Nov 30, 2012

Dance New Amsterdam (DNA) champions experimentation in its rowdy DNA PRESENTS season LateNite series. Giving voice to artists working within the mediums of performance art, burlesque and experimental movement theater, DNA warmlywelcomes back Jaamil Olawale Kosoko, this time in his two-night New York City curatorial debut, other.explicit.bodies. Kosoko will perform a solo during the first night's performance. The show and its platform of otherness and eroticism are a direct extension of Kosoko's solo work other.explicit.body., which premiered at Harlem Stage E-moves in April 2012. Performances of other.explicit.bodies. are January 11 and 12. All shows are at 10 p.m.
